Miss Worrell - Verified booking
I spent a lovely week at Malsters Studio, and it was perfect for my sort of holiday. I was looking for a base from which to explore a stretch of the coastal path, and it was a great place to come back to at the end of long days out. Very cosy and warm with underfloor heating and lovely hot shower, good wifi for planning the next day's walk, and practical design and layout. Parking space on the drive right next to the studio was really convenient. The owners were just next door, and really friendly and helpful, although you definitely still have your privacy. The location was great - it was about an hour's walk into Padstow along the Little Petherick Creek, which forms part of the Saints Way, and you could also easily access the Camel Trail. If you enjoy walking then this is the perfect spot as it offers access not only to the South West coastal path at Padstow, but also the opportunity to explore some of the inland long distance trails as well.
